  2. Actress: Lovecraft Country. Monique Kathleen Candelaria was born February 11th, 1987 in Albuquerque, New Mexico to Carla Bernadette Castillo and David Robert Candelaria. Soon after she was born her father joined the army and they moved to Bremerhaven, Germany where her brother, David A. Candelaria, was born.
